Driivz, a Vontier company, powers the e-mobility revolution with a market-leading, end-to-end EV Charging and Energy Management platform for global charge point operators and electric mobility service providers.
We offer a scalable, integrated SaaS solution that enables our clients to efficiently manage their networks and provide EV drivers with exceptional charging experience.
Operating in over 35 countries in the US, Europe and Asia, we enable hundreds of millions of events for millions of EV drivers and manage more than 200,000 public chargers (100,000s in roaming).
Our customers include global industry leaders such as EVgo, Volvo Group, Shell, Circle K, Mer, Recharge, Kople, ESB, CEZ, MOL Group, ST1, and eMobility Power.

WHO IS VONTIER Vontier (NYSE: VNT) is a global technology company powering the way the world moves. We empower businesses in the transport sector to adapt to a fast-changing landscape by uniting productivity, automation and multi-energy technologies.
Our smart, connected solutions serve roadside convenience retail stores, fleet operators, and auto repair technicians. From integrated payments and EV charging software to carwash technology and retail automation, we help customers stay productive and prepared for a rapidly evolving industry.
With decades of expertise and a balanced portfolio, Vontier enables businesses to navigate complexity, unlock growth, and build a cleaner, safer future.
